Ruellia prostrata Poir.

This species is native to Central African Republic, extending to Eritrea and S Africa, Arabian Peninsula, Indian Subcontinent, Christmas Island and SW Pacific. (Ref. POWO; 2023). There are 6 species of Ruellia found in Oman. (Ref. Oman Botanic Garden).

Much branched small shrub ; up to 1 m tall . Stems erect to ascending , branching from base , green to greyish green , pubescent . Leaves 25–70 × 15–40 mm , ovate to ovate-oblong , apex obtuse , base rounded to shortly cuneate , margins entire or undulate , pubescent ; petiole up to 2 cm . Inflorescences 1–3 , in the axils of leaves . Flowers violet to pale purple , funnel-shaped , short-lived ; calyx 10–15 mm , 5-lobed with linear-lanceolate lobes ; corolla violet to pale purple , funnel-shaped , expanded and 5-lobed above ; tube ± 15 mm ; lobes ± 5 mm ; stamens 4 ; anthers parallel ; style persisting in mature capsule . Fruit capsule , ± 15–20 mm , ellipsoid , greenish when mature , finely pubescent with adpressed hairs , many-seeded . Seeds 3–4 × 3–4 mm , flat , orbicular , grey to brown . (Ref . Flora of Oman ; vol . 3) .
